Solve the biggest ligature risk in mental health

Doors present the greatest ligature risk in mental health inpatient facilities. When we look at the figures from The National Confidential Inquiry into Suicide and Safety in Mental Health (NCISH), they paint a stark picture: 90% occur in the patient’s bedroom or bathroom 91% occur under intermittent observations 46% occur using the door or door… Read more »
